In NFL terms, the season is in the first quarter of week 2 and the Astros have started…well the season has certainly started. The pitching has been unsustainably good and the offense has been unsustainably bad. Both are due for some reversion to the mean, but who knows what that will look like. It will take until mid-June to get a feel for how good or bad this team actually is. With that out of the way, here are a few Astros thoughts.
LMJ should accept that he can’t start anymore
Since 2018, Lance McCullers has pitched over 100 innings in only one season, 2021, and even then he got hurt in the playoffs that year.
